XCORE

Unverified contract

Proxy

Active on Ethereum with 429 txns
Deployed by via 0x3ba62bce at 21217003
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
12 additional variables

No balances found for "XCORE"

0x6ab75c5beebf7d1923e18f44b7b571517073f9cda3fce4502f4bc146654e4776
0x1a607516d430e9d4ce1860b2ed7654bcd4d2f66ab0697fecb6705f1343b468e9
0xc605e16f68ab3e2083d59ae29fccce5589d0ed7a23f21d67ed491bd7fc3d599d
From
0xf9f48c864af5819291aaabe014f40da97f230cc654924162021c77bbbe1357ef
0x325b8f6d37a4247b9b0307467d969ad2362d3e8e57acf4d4885d350cc37a6105
0x0e7c5abfb04206d1b54c99af5865831c5c2625512d518f35b82b075476704c4e
0x78fcfd3a27216007ad0e1da2de9568ebaf6d8708a9defdea54258627638ff62c
0xd37448f7f23838ed6a82f2a8cdb3cdf0c6104607516f7c085f6c74501492be0b
0x7fedcbde0fb8afdb97754cd6c6c01f6bfc4d5231cda2d456822c5ef899d8d108
0x60dc53da44ee380a6e5773d833a38a8e1845f8010ba422b46377a478cc8ed8ab

Functions
Getter at block 21268856
admin(view returns (address)
0x540fd8688d57b4cfaed06993892fe304eba62af1
adminACLContract(view returns (address)
0x540fd8688d57b4cfaed06993892fe304eba62af1
allowArtistProjectActivation(view returns (bool)
true
artblocksDependencyRegistryAddress(view returns (address)
0x0000000000000000000000000000000000000000
artblocksOnChainGeneratorAddress(view returns (address)
0x0000000000000000000000000000000000000000
autoApproveArtistSplitProposals(view returns (bool)
true
bytecodeStorageReaderContract(view returns (address)
0x000000000000a791abed33872c44a3d215a3743b
coreType(pure returns (string)
GenArt721CoreV3_Engine_Flex
coreVersion(pure returns (string)
v3.2.5
defaultBaseURI(view returns (string)
https://token.artblocks.io/0xc04e0000726ed7c5b9f0045bc0c4806321bc6c65/
defaultPlatformProviderSecondarySalesAddress(view returns (address)
0xa4acfe833b9aaa3c488c05dcbc9dcd29a8252c84
defaultPlatformProviderSecondarySalesBPS(view returns (uint256)
0
defaultRenderProviderSecondarySalesAddress(view returns (address)
0xa9f7c2b5fd91c842b2e1b839a1cf0f3de2a24249
defaultRenderProviderSecondarySalesBPS(view returns (uint256)
250
minterContract(view returns (address)
0xa2ccfe293bc2cdd78d8166a82d1e18cd2148122b
name(view returns (string)
XCORE
newProjectsForbidden(view returns (bool)
false
nextCoreContract(view returns (address)
0x0000000000000000000000000000000000000000
nextProjectId(view returns (uint256)
1
nullPlatformProvider(view returns (bool)
false
numHistoricalRandomizers(view returns (uint256)
1
owner(view returns (address)
0x540fd8688d57b4cfaed06993892fe304eba62af1
platformProviderPrimarySalesAddress(view returns (address)
0xa4acfe833b9aaa3c488c05dcbc9dcd29a8252c84
platformProviderPrimarySalesPercentage(view returns (uint256)
0
preferredArweaveGateway(view returns (string)
preferredIPFSGateway(view returns (string)
randomizerContract(view returns (address)
0x13178a7a8a1a9460dbe39f7eccebd91b31752b91
renderProviderPrimarySalesAddress(view returns (address)
0xa9f7c2b5fd91c842b2e1b839a1cf0f3de2a24249
renderProviderPrimarySalesPercentage(view returns (uint256)
20
splitProvider(view returns (address)
0x0000000004b100b47f061968a387c82702afe946
startingProjectId(view returns (uint256)
0
symbol(view returns (string)
XCORE
Read-only
balanceOf(address ownerview returns (uint256)
getApproved(uint256 tokenIdview returns (address)
getCompressed(string _scriptpure returns (bytes)
getHistoricalRandomizerAt(uint256 _indexview returns (address)
getPrimaryRevenueSplits(uint256 _projectIduint256 _priceview returns (uint256 renderProviderRevenue_address renderProviderAddress_uint256 platformProviderRevenue_address platformProviderAddress_uint256 artistRevenue_address artistAddress_uint256 additionalPayeePrimaryRevenue_address additionalPayeePrimaryAddress_)
isApprovedForAll(address owneraddress operatorview returns (bool)
isMintWhitelisted(address _minterview returns (bool)
ownerOf(uint256 tokenIdview returns (address)
projectDetails(uint256 _projectIdview returns (string projectNamestring artiststring descriptionstring websitestring license)
projectExternalAssetDependencyByIndex(uint256 _projectIduint256 _indexview returns (struct IGenArt721CoreContractV3_Engine_FlexExternalAssetDependencyWithData)
projectExternalAssetDependencyCount(uint256 _projectIdview returns (uint256)
projectIdToArtistAddress(uint256 _projectIdview returns (address)
projectIdToFinancials(uint256 _projectIdview returns (struct IGenArt721CoreContractV3_ProjectFinanceProjectFinance)
projectIdToSecondaryMarketRoyaltyPercentage(uint256 _projectIdview returns (uint256)
projectScriptByIndex(uint256 _projectIduint256 _indexview returns (string)
projectScriptBytecodeAddressByIndex(uint256 _projectIduint256 _indexview returns (address)
projectScriptDetails(uint256 _projectIdview returns (string scriptTypeAndVersionstring aspectRatiouint256 scriptCount)
projectStateData(uint256 _projectIdview returns (uint256 invocationsuint256 maxInvocationsbool activebool pauseduint256 completedTimestampbool locked)
projectURIInfo(uint256 _projectIdview returns (string projectBaseURI)
proposedArtistAddressesAndSplitsHash(uint256view returns (bytes32)
royaltyInfo(uint256 _tokenIduint256 _salePriceview returns (address receiveruint256 royaltyAmount)
supportsInterface(bytes4 interfaceIdview returns (bool)
tokenIdToHash(uint256 _tokenIdview returns (bytes32)
tokenIdToHashSeed(uint256 _tokenIdview returns (bytes12)
tokenIdToProjectId(uint256 _tokenIdpure returns (uint256 _projectId)
tokenURI(uint256 _tokenIdview returns (string)
State-modifying
addProject(string _projectNameaddress _artistAddress
addProjectAssetDependencyOnChainAtAddress(uint256 _projectIdaddress _assetAddress
addProjectExternalAssetDependency(uint256 _projectIdstring _cidOrDatauint8 _dependencyType
addProjectExternalAssetDependencyOnChainCompressed(uint256 _projectIdbytes _compressedString
addProjectScript(uint256 _projectIdstring _script
addProjectScriptCompressed(uint256 _projectIdbytes _compressedScript
adminACLAllowed(address _senderaddress _contractbytes4 _selectorreturns (bool)
adminAcceptArtistAddressesAndSplits(uint256 _projectIdaddress _artistAddressaddress _additionalPayeePrimarySalesuint256 _additionalPayeePrimarySalesPercentageaddress _additionalPayeeSecondarySalesuint256 _additionalPayeeSecondarySalesPercentage
approve(address touint256 tokenId
forbidNewProjects(
initialize(struct EngineConfiguration engineConfigurationaddress adminACLContract_string defaultBaseURIHostaddress bytecodeStorageReaderContract_
lockProjectExternalAssetDependencies(uint256 _projectId
mint_Ecf(address _touint256 _projectIdaddress _byreturns (uint256 _tokenId)
proposeArtistPaymentAddressesAndSplits(uint256 _projectIdaddress _artistAddressaddress _additionalPayeePrimarySalesuint256 _additionalPayeePrimarySalesPercentageaddress _additionalPayeeSecondarySalesuint256 _additionalPayeeSecondarySalesPercentage
removeProjectExternalAssetDependency(uint256 _projectIduint256 _index
removeProjectLastScript(uint256 _projectId
renounceOwnership(
safeTransferFrom(address fromaddress touint256 tokenId
safeTransferFrom(address fromaddress touint256 tokenIdbytes data
setApprovalForAll(address operatorbool approved
setTokenHash_8PT(uint256 _tokenIdbytes32 _hashSeed
syncProviderSecondaryForProjectToDefaults(uint256 _projectId
toggleProjectIsActive(uint256 _projectId
toggleProjectIsPaused(uint256 _projectId
transferFrom(address fromaddress touint256 tokenId
transferOwnership(address newOwner
updateArtblocksDependencyRegistryAddress(address _artblocksDependencyRegistryAddress
updateArtblocksOnChainGeneratorAddress(address _artblocksOnChainGeneratorAddress
updateArweaveGateway(string _gateway
updateBytecodeStorageReaderContract(address _bytecodeStorageReaderContract
updateDefaultBaseURI(string _defaultBaseURI
updateIPFSGateway(string _gateway
updateMinterContract(address _address
updateNextCoreContract(address _nextCoreContract
updateProjectArtistAddress(uint256 _projectIdaddress _artistAddress
updateProjectArtistName(uint256 _projectIdstring _projectArtistName
updateProjectAspectRatio(uint256 _projectIdstring _aspectRatio
updateProjectAssetDependencyOnChainAtAddress(uint256 _projectIduint256 _indexaddress _assetAddress
updateProjectBaseURI(uint256 _projectIdstring _newBaseURI
updateProjectDescription(uint256 _projectIdstring _projectDescription
updateProjectExternalAssetDependency(uint256 _projectIduint256 _indexstring _cidOrDatauint8 _dependencyType
updateProjectExternalAssetDependencyOnChainCompressed(uint256 _projectIduint256 _indexbytes _compressedString
updateProjectLicense(uint256 _projectIdstring _projectLicense
updateProjectMaxInvocations(uint256 _projectIduint24 _maxInvocations
updateProjectName(uint256 _projectIdstring _projectName
updateProjectScript(uint256 _projectIduint256 _scriptIdstring _script
updateProjectScriptCompressed(uint256 _projectIduint256 _scriptIdbytes _compressedScript
updateProjectScriptType(uint256 _projectIdbytes32 _scriptTypeAndVersion
updateProjectSecondaryMarketRoyaltyPercentage(uint256 _projectIduint256 _secondaryMarketRoyalty
updateProjectWebsite(uint256 _projectIdstring _projectWebsite
updateProviderDefaultSecondarySalesBPS(uint256 _defaultRenderProviderSecondarySalesBPSuint256 _defaultPlatformProviderSecondarySalesBPS
updateProviderPrimarySalesPercentages(uint256 renderProviderPrimarySalesPercentage_uint256 platformProviderPrimarySalesPercentage_
updateProviderSalesAddresses(address _renderProviderPrimarySalesAddressaddress _defaultRenderProviderSecondarySalesAddressaddress _platformProviderPrimarySalesAddressaddress _defaultPlatformProviderSecondarySalesAddress
updateRandomizerAddress(address _randomizerAddress
updateSplitProvider(address _splitProviderAddress
Events
AcceptedArtistAddressesAndSplits(uint256 indexed _projectId
Approval(address indexed owneraddress indexed approveduint256 indexed tokenId
ApprovalForAll(address indexed owneraddress indexed operatorbool approved
ExternalAssetDependencyRemoved(uint256 indexed _projectIduint256 indexed _index
ExternalAssetDependencyUpdated(uint256 indexed _projectIduint256 indexed _indexstring _ciduint8 _dependencyTypeuint24 _externalAssetDependencyCount
GatewayUpdated(uint8 indexed _dependencyTypestring _gatewayAddress
Mint(address indexed _touint256 indexed _tokenId
MinterUpdated(address indexed _currentMinter
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
PlatformUpdated(bytes32 indexed _field
ProjectExternalAssetDependenciesLocked(uint256 indexed _projectId
ProjectRoyaltySplitterUpdated(uint256 indexed projectIdaddress indexed royaltySplitter
ProjectUpdated(uint256 indexed _projectIdbytes32 indexed _update
ProposedArtistAddressesAndSplits(uint256 indexed _projectIdaddress _artistAddressaddress _additionalPayeePrimarySalesuint256 _additionalPayeePrimarySalesPercentageaddress _additionalPayeeSecondarySalesuint256 _additionalPayeeSecondarySalesPercentage
Transfer(address indexed fromaddress indexed touint256 indexed tokenId
Constructor

This contract contains no constructor objects.

Fallback and receive

This contract contains no fallback and receive objects.

Errors
ERC721IncorrectOwner(address senderuint256 tokenIdaddress owner
ERC721InsufficientApproval(address operatoruint256 tokenId
ERC721InvalidApprover(address approver
ERC721InvalidOperator(address operator
ERC721InvalidOwner(address owner
ERC721InvalidReceiver(address receiver
ERC721InvalidSender(address sender
ERC721NonexistentToken(uint256 tokenId
GenArt721Error(uint8 _errorCode
OwnableInvalidOwner(address owner
OwnableUnauthorizedAccount(address account
StringsInsufficientHexLength(uint256 valueuint256 length